This document contains data from an experiment measuring the change in mass and volume of potato cores submerged in different molar concentrations of sucrose solution. It shows that potato cores generally increased in mass and volume in lower molarity sucrose solutions between 0.0M and 0.2M, and decreased in mass and volume in higher molarity solutions of 0.6M and 0.8M, with the highest percentage changes occurring in the 0.2M and 0.1M solutions.
